Carving a smoked ham is a straightforward process. Prepare the Ham: Before carving, allow the smoked ham to rest for a few minutes after removing it from the smoker. This allows the juices to redistribute, making the meat juicier and easier to carve. Locate the Bone: Identify where the bone is located in the ham.

Smoking at a temperature between 225-250 °F (107-212 °C) will result in the most flavorful and juicy bone-in ham, as this range is best for allowing fat to render and drip off of the meat as it cooks. Due to its higher moisture content, you need to be careful when smoking this cut of meat.

Both fresh and smoked ham bones need to be cooked thoroughly before eating and do best when simmered slowly for hours in a pot of soup. Just settle the entire whole ham bone into the middle of the pot and let it cook. Once the meat becomes so tender that it falls off the bone, scoop out the big pieces, shred them, and return them to the pot.
